#810809 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#810809 is composed of 50.6% red, 3.1%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 93%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 359.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 26.9%. #810809 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1012 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#810809 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#810809 has RGB values of R:129, G:8,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.93,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8456201.

Shades and Tints of #810809
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120101 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#810809
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474242 is the less saturated color, while #860304 is the most saturated one.
